Swifts hit a purple patch

FOOTBALL: LUTTERWORTH Town made one of their shorter trips on Saturday when travelling away to Long Buckby.

The low mileage had a positive impact on the Swifts as they picked up another three points following a solid 3-0 win.

It’s Swifts’ second league win within a week after beating Huntingdon 2-0 at home in the previous league encounter.

The game kicked off with Lutterworth looking the stronger side and dangerous on both flanks.




Buckby’s main threat came in the form of their speedy left winger, who Callum Riley did well to neutralise and keep the Swifts on the front foot.

On 18 mins the Swifts were in front after a high searching diagonal pass from centre-half Brooks saw Tendai Daire outsmart the defender and bring down the pass.


He then beared down on goal and smashing past the keeper.

Lutterworth were collectively strong and gave the home side no time in the middle of the park. And before long they made it two.

An excellent move which started with a marauding Louis Samuels who found Marshal Keenan on the left. Keenan then jinked into the box and squared to Daire, who scored his and Town’s second.

It took the Swifts just two minutes to open their second half account. Tendai Daire’s effort in chasing down a lost cause proved to be worthy as he was able to dispossess the defender and return the favour to the onrushing Keenan.

Keenan then fashioned a much more favourable angle and made no mistake in finding the corner.

The game was then out of sight for Buckby, who did still try to finder their impressive winger but man of the match Shaun Leslie kept him at bay and nullified the threat well.

The game finished 0-3 and the Swifts could have easily added to the tally.

Swifts are next in action when they host Buckingham Town on Saturday in the league.

Swifts: Kristian Bee, Callum Riley, Shaun Leslie (motm), Shaquille O’Neal Brooks, Mark Warren, Liam Taylor, Rhys Roberts, Marshal Keenan, Lynas King, Tendai Daire (C). Subs: Tom Marrs, Kade Lewis, William Clarke, Emmanuel Ndlovu.
